Kinds Of French Doors
Before picking installation, it's important to understand the range of French doors available:
| Type | Description |
|---|---|
| Wood French Doors | Traditional and timeless; they provide excellent insulation but require routine upkeep. |
| Vinyl French Doors | Low upkeep and energy-efficient; they can imitate the look of wood without the upkeep. |
| Fiberglass French Doors | Resilient and energy-efficient; they can hold up against various weather without warping. |
| Aluminum French Doors | Streamlined and modern; they offer strength and durability with very little maintenance. |

Maintenance Tips for French Doors
To keep your French doors looking excellent and functioning successfully, follow these upkeep suggestions:
- Regular Cleaning: Wipe down the frames and glass with a wet cloth to eliminate dust and gunk.
- Inspect Seals: Check the weather removing periodically and change it if worn or harmed.
- Lubricate Hinges: Keep the hinges and locks oiled to guarantee smooth operation.
- Paint and Stain: Repaint or stain wooden doors as required to safeguard against weather elements.
